The Perk: >**More than just an Illusion (-600 CP, Discount for Mastermind):** You've created this giant world, and done all of this, but to some people it's meaningless. This world, all this effort, the wonders that lie within, to some people it's just an illusion. However, in the World of Fate, an illusion can have power. There exists a magecraft called Projection. It creates the shell of an image that the caster desires, and is generally seen as worthless. However, Shirou Emiya took that craft and made Tracing. By providing details to the swords he projected, their history, their materials, their forging, and so much more, he was able to turn a fragile illusion of a sword and turn it into something that can interact with the world as real as any object. With this, he even managed to replicate Noble Phantasms. Now, you possess the ability to do the same, with equal or greater skill than Counter Guardian EMIYA in this craft. Not just with swords, but with any illusion you can create. > >The more details you possess, the greater density of data you have on an object, the more real you can make it. And well, you certainly aren't lacking in details as you are. An entire floating castle, myriad of monsters within, mountains of weapons and armor, and all of which have gained interactions and history through interactions with all of the trapped players within. With but a thought and some magical energy, real monsters could run amok under your control. With the right ritual to gather the energy, you could summon an entire floating castle in the sky. > >However, it doesn't need to stop there. This perk gives you one other bonus. If you've made an illusion realistic enough, to the point where there is almost no difference between the illusion and something real, then you can push it over the edge. You can make an illusion you created into something real. This is, however, a permanent act. You cannot manipulate it any more like you could an illusion, and you cannot reverse the process either. However, this doesn't stop that from being a truly impressive feat.
